How your approach to food when you go travelling may indicate whether you would be a perfect employee for Google Go on, load your plate high. Who doesn’t love an Ethiopian buffet? A while back*, Google wanted to determine what one question (and only one question) they could ask in an interview that would be the best predictor of whether the interviewee would be successful at Google. So, Google being Google, they analysed all the interview questions they had ever asked and correlated these to the progress each of the interviewees had subsequently made in the company. Joanna McIsaac-Kierklo in Dublin Many retirees, freed from their work obligations and looking for adventure, dream of living overseas. Edward Kierklo and Joanna McIsaac-Kierklo don’t dream. They just do. In May 2021, the couple, feeling trapped by the pandemic in their sleepy town in the Sierra Foothills east of San Francisco, decided to break out and trade rural life for 11 months in London. Joanna’s always been a risk-taker, starting at 22, when she moved to Idaho to be a Vista volunteer.
